Job Description

We are seeking a highly organised and customer-focused Remote Subscription Services Assistant to join our growing team. In this pivotal role, you will be responsible for providing comprehensive support to our subscribers, managing their accounts, resolving inquiries, and ensuring a seamless experience with our digital and print products. This is a 100% remote position, offering the flexibility to work from your home office while being an integral part of a leading media organisation.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ide first-class customer service via email, chat, and phone regarding subscription inquiries, billing, and technical issues.
  • Manage subscriber accounts, including activations, modifications, renewals, and cancellations.
  • Troubleshoot access issues for digital subscriptions and guide users through platform features.
  • Process payments and refunds accurately and efficiently.
  • Document all customer interactions and resolutions in our CRM system.
  • Identify and escalate complex issues to senior team members when necessary.
  • Collaborate with internal teams (e.g., tech support, editorial) to ensure timely resolution of subscriber concerns.
  • Contribute to the continuous improvement of subscription service processes and customer satisfaction.
